Next Saturday 9, Venturada will be the setting for an intergenerational debate within the framework of Ventu-Ciencia, where experts and young people will discuss future challenges in the scientific field.

The initiative aims to foster reflection and the exchange of ideas between different generations, emphasizing that scientific progress knows no age limits and is built with everyone's contribution. The event will take place at Cotos de Monterrey, Venturada, at 6:00 PM.
Confirmed participants include prominent figures in journalism and scientific research. A journalist and moderator from The Conversation, a scientific researcher from the CSIC, and a doctor in Physical Sciences from CIEMAT will contribute their vast experience.
Additionally, a journalist and director of ADIO.FM will join the panel, along with students from local educational centers such as GSD Buitrago and IES La Cabrera. This combination of experience and youth promises an enriching and open conversation about the future of science.
